    Has anyone tried this out in SSE? I put a request in on the SSE Mod Request forums, but didn't get any response. I don't have Skyrim installed right now to test it out. If I don't get any replies, I'll give it a shot next time since SKSE is mostly working for SSE now.

    EDIT: Ported it myself and it seems to be working perfectly. I converted the esp using the Creation Kit and just dropped the pex file into the proper folder for SKSE.

      When I was working on Better Free Camera I had add code to prevent allowing someone going into free camera mode while in dialogue because it would break the game. I have a feeling that mod author removed his mod because he experienced the same problem. Basically messing around with the camera mode in Skyrim while in dialogue is a bad idea with how the engine works.

    Am I right: it's the same as I use the console command, but it scales the time automatically while in dialogue menu?
    1. utopium
      utopium
      • account closed
      • 141 kudos
      Yup. Basically the rest of your game will have a normal timescale but whenever you start a dialogue with an NPC the timescale will be changed for the duration of that conversation to the one configured in the MCM menu.
